No one enjoys thinking about getting sick. Even more than that, no one enjoys thinking about spending money they may or may not have an insurance that they may or may not meet. It gets incredibly easy to convince oneself that they don't actually need health insurance because they hardly ever get sick.

Of course, the simple truth is that health insurance is mostly for emergency situations. And when those emergency situations happen, it doesn't take long before you wish that you really had health insurance. The truth of that does not actually change the fact that health insurance can get expensive. Health insurance was certainly made easier to get thanks to the Affordable Care Act, but unfortunately the Affordable Care Act was mostly focused on helping those of low-income get health insurance.


If you make enough to live comfortably, but not enough to really put aside money into a savings account, then you may feel as though the Affordable Care Act hasn't helped you. This is a fair way of thinking, and speaks to problems that the Affordable Care Act has had since it was put into law. If you live in one of the states that has implemented the Affordable Care Act, and your options are much easier. Part of the Affordable Care Act is the Insurance Exchange, which ensures that people are capable of finding affordable health care quickly and easily. The Exchange is set up in such a way as to ensure that people can browse through the various health care plans, and see what's available without having to do a great deal of detailed research. The exchange also ensures that people don't have to know quite as much about how insurance works to get the insurance that they need.
